They have given it... 9/10! +Brilliant. An absolute riot. +Amazingly fun co-op. +Car handling is excellent. +Abilities liven up the genre. -Missions not varied enough. Heres what they said in the final paragraph... "For outrageousness and pure entertainment value, Crackdown is the most fun sandbox game to date. It's arguably a little unfocused as a single-player game, but get a mate to join and this becomes one of Xbox Live's killer-apps. It's a game that screams fun - a truly brilliant addition to the sandbox part. Crackdown is style. Crackdown is all-out fun. Crackdown is and absolute riot!" You sir do not know what you speak. Crackdown has 3 island districts. Each District is run by a specific gang and each gang has 7 increasing hard henchmen to take down then its district kingpin. Also there is the game mechanic of using your abilities to become stronger at that ability. I would bet there is 7 hours of gameplay finding the 500 orbs increasing agility alone.
